Divalproex(Depakote, Depakote ER) is used to treat: 1. focal impaired awareness seizures 2. absence seizures 3. mixed seizure types Divalproex increases availability of gamma aminobutyric acid (GABA). GABA is an inhibitory neurotransmitter, which means it slows down the nerve circuits.
